TrackUseCase

class TrackUseCase(tagManager: TagManager, pageViewRepository: PageViewTrackRepository, addToCartRepository: AddToCartTrackRepository, purchaseRepository: PurchaseTrackRepository)(source)

Constructors

Link copied to clipboard
constructor(tagManager: TagManager, pageViewRepository: PageViewTrackRepository, addToCartRepository: AddToCartTrackRepository, purchaseRepository: PurchaseTrackRepository)

Functions

Link copied to clipboard
suspend fun trackAddToCart(params: AddToCartParams)
Link copied to clipboard
suspend fun trackPageView(params: PageViewParams)
Link copied to clipboard
suspend fun trackPurchase(params: PurchaseParams)